The 'user_id' and 'project_id' parameter descriptions for server actions
imply that they are the value of the user/project that owns the server,
but that is incorrect - they are the project/user id of whoever made the
request/initiated the action.
The existing project_id_instance_action parameter variable, which is only
used by the os-cloudpipe reference, is renamed to avoid confusion with
instance actions.

This adds the changes-before filter to the servers,
os-instance-actions and os-migrations APIs for
filtering resources which were last updated before
or equal to the given time. The changes-before filter,
like the changes-since filter, will return deleted
server resources.

This patch adds a new microversion to
``GET /servers/{server_id}/os-instance-actions/{req_id}`` API to
include the ``host`` field for admin and an ``hostId`` for all users
by default. And the display of newly added ``host`` field will be
controlled by the same policy as the ``traceback`` field.
The newly added fields can be used to determine on which host a
given action event occurred.

This patch adds pagination support and changes-since filter
for os-instance-actions API.
Users can now use 'limit' and 'marker' to perform paginate
query of instance action list. Users can also filter the
results according to the actions' updated time.

Allow Cinder to use external events to signal a volume extension.
1) Nova will then call os-brick to perform the volume extension
so the host can detect its new size.
2) Compute driver will resize the device in QEMU so instance can detect
the new disk size without rebooting.
This change:
* Adds the 'volume-extended' external event.
The event tag needs to be the extended volume id.
* Bumps the latest microversion to 2.51.
* Exposes non-traceback instance action event details for
non-admins on the microversion. This is needed for the
non-admin API user that initiated the volume extend
operation to be able to tell when the nova-compute side
is complete.

For "GET /servers/{server_id}/os-instance-actions/{request_id}",
the "events" parameter in the response body is only included by
default policy for administrators. You can get details if you're
an admin or own the server, but the events are only returned for
admins by default.
This change does two things:
1. Fixes the description of the default policy since admin or
owner can get action details for a particular request.
2. Fixes the "events" parameter description by pointing out it
is optional and only returned by default for admins.
